29 CFR  1926.20(b)(1):It shall be the responsibility of the employer to initiate and maintain such programs as may be necessary to comply with this part.  a. On or before November 9, 2022, at the worksite located at 8428 Graystone Drive Pickerington Ohio 43147 Lot #12, the employer failed to initiate and maintain a safety and health program such as but not limited to a scaffolding safety program and fall protection program.

29 CFR  1926.451(c)(2):Supported scaffold poles, legs, posts, frames, and uprights shall bear on base plates and mud sills or other adequate firm foundation.  a. On or before November 9, 2022, at the worksite located at 8428 Graystone Drive Pickerington Ohio 43147 Lot #12, the employer did not provide base plates or mud sills for the scaffolding legs. The employees used the scaffolding without adequate firm foundation and rested the scaffolding legs on loose gravel, thereby being exposed to fall hazards of up to 12 feet.

29 CFR  1926.451(e)(1):When scaffold platforms are more than 2 feet (0.6 m) above or below a point of access, portable ladders, hook-on ladders, attachable ladders, stair towers (scaffold stairways/towers), stairway-type ladders (such as ladder stands), ramps, walkways, integral prefabricated scaffold access, or direct access from another scaffold, structure, personnel hoist, or similar surface shall be used. Crossbraces shall not be used as a means of access.  a. On or before November 9, 2022, at the worksite located at 8428 Graystone Drive Pickerington Ohio 43147 Lot #12, the employer did not provide a safe means of access to scaffold platforms. Employees used the edge sections of a scaffold frame to access the working platform, thereby being exposed to a fall hazard of heights up to 18 feet.

29 CFR  1926.451(g)(1): Each employee on a scaffold more than 10 feet (3.1 m) above a lower level shall be protected from falling to that lower level. Paragraphs (g)(1)(i) through (vii) of this section establish the types of fall protection to be provided to the employees on each type of scaffold. Paragraph (g)(2) of this section addresses fall protection for scaffold erectors and dismantlers.   a. On or before November 9, 2022 at the worksite located at 8428 Graystone Drive Pickerington Ohio 43147 Lot #12, the employer did not ensure that the employees were protected while working on scaffolding while working at heights of over 10 feet to the lower level.  The employees were working on scaffolding at heights of greater than 10 feet without any means of fall protection thereby being exposed to fall hazards of up to 18 feet.
